Instructions: Phase One – Read each word to the student. Have the student repeat the word back and then say the word with the first sound removed. Example - Biz becomes iz Phase Two – Read each word to the student. Have the student then say the word with the first sound removed. (Same as above except student does not repeat word) Phase Three – Have student do exercise on their own. Reading the word themselves and then saying the word without the first sound
Notes: Many of these will be nonsense words. The important thing is sound recognition and differentiation. So if a word has a completely different sound with the first letter removed that is okay. Use the phonetic version. Do only as many as is comfortable each day. Do not overdo it. If it's only one line that's fine. Build up until it's easy and more can be done
